DOV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

665 of the 3,447 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Dover (DOV)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$11.4B — down 13% from $13.2B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 56 funds opened new DOV positions and 39 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 221 added to existing stakes and 243 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Virtus Fund Advisers, adding an estimated $65.7M. The largest seller was Capital Research Global Investors, cutting an estimated $142M.
